Abstract

Disclosed is a rice washing device which can be mounted directly in an inner pot of an electrical rice cooker and be used. The present invention provides the rice washing device for washing rice for cooking, and is characterized by including: an upper panel having multiple mounting parts formed around an outer circumferential side to be coupled to a flange of the inner pot; a handle part which is mounted on an upper part of the upper panel to be rotated and is rotated by a user who grabs the handle part; and a wing part connected to the handle part by a shaft, and having multiple washing wings formed on a lower part of the handle unit.

Device to wash rice

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a rice washing machine, and more particularly, to a rice washing machine that can be directly mounted on an inner pot of an electric rice cooker.

Generally, a rice washing machine (aka: Semi) is used to easily clean rice when cooking at home.

As such a rice washing machine, there is a motorized rice washing machine in the past. The electric rice washing machine has a high unit price, a heavy burden due to power consumption, and a problem that it is difficult to use in a place where power supply is difficult. In order to solve such a problem, a conventional manual rice washing machine has been disclosed.

1 is a perspective view showing a conventional manual rice washing machine. As shown in FIG. 1, a conventional manual rice washing machine can be used in a state in which a lid 2 is mounted on a semicircle 1 on which a scale 7 is formed.

The lid 2 is provided with a stirring blade 3 at its lower portion and a handle 18 formed at an upper portion thereof to rotate the stirring blade 3 by rotating the handle 18. The handle 18 is also rotatably mounted on the lid 2 with the boss 12 and the screw 17 fastened thereto.

A handle 5 for gripping is formed in the semicylinder 8 and a water portion 4 for discharging water after rice washing is formed on one side of the upper end. (11) is formed.

A conventional hand-held rice washer having such a configuration can press the lid 2 onto the semicylinder 8 through the knob 9 and mount it. At this time, the semi-barrel (8) is made of a transparent material, and the appropriate level of water can be adjusted by placing rice for washing in a container.

When the user rotates the handle 18 by covering the lid 2 in this state with the rice and the water filled in the semicylinder 8, the lower stirring vane 3 is rotated in one direction, The rice was washed by hand.

However, in the conventional manual rice washing machine, the lid 2 and the semicylinder 8 must be provided at the time of use, since the semicylander 8 and the lid 2 can be used while being fastened to each other. Therefore, there is a problem that it is inconvenient to use, and the unit price of the product is increased. In addition, there is a problem that it is troublesome to clean the semicylinder 8 separately after washing the rice, and there is a problem that the semicheon 8 can not be easily stored and carried.

It is an object of the present invention to provide a rice washing machine that is simple in use and structurally simple because it is designed to solve the above problems and can be directly mounted on an inner pot of an electromagnetic cooker.

According to an aspect of the present invention, there is provided a rice washing machine for washing rice during cooking, the rice washing machine comprising: a top plate part formed along an outer circumferential surface of a plurality of mounting parts to be fastened to a flange of an inner pot of an electric rice cooker; A handle portion rotatably mounted on an upper portion of the upper plate portion and rotated by a user; And a wing portion connected to the handle portion via a rotation shaft and having a plurality of cleaning wings formed under the rotation shaft.

And a lid part which is rotatably installed at one side of the upper plate part and is openable and closable in a state where the upper plate part is mounted to the inner pot.

A plurality of the mounting portions are arranged in correspondence with the flanges of the inner pot, and slit grooves are formed to insert a part of the flange, so that the upper plate can be mounted on the inner pot.

The upper plate may have a convex shape, and at least one reinforcing plate may protrude from the upper surface.

A plurality of slit holes may be formed in a part of the upper plate so that the inner pot can be drained while the upper plate is mounted on the inner pot.

At least two of the cleaning blades are formed to be symmetrical with respect to each other and may be formed to have a sufficient size to be in close contact with a part of the inner circumferential surface of the inner pot.

According to the present invention, the rice washing machine can be mounted by fitting the flange of the inner pot of the rice cooker into the mounting portion formed on the upper plate portion, thereby providing a simple effect.

In addition, since the inner pot of the conventional rice cooker is used as the rice washing container, the rice washer can be installed in the inner pot without having to provide a separate semi-container, so that the structure is simple and portable.

2 to 7, the rice washing machine of the present invention mainly comprises the upper plate portion 20, the handle portion 30, and the wing portion 40.

In the above-described configuration, the upper plate portion 20 has a convex shape at the top and is preferably circular. This means that it is formed in a circular shape so as to be easily fastened to the upper part of the inner pot 50 and a convex shape so that the water easily flows down to the side on the upper plate 20 in the semi-process. Also, the upper plate 20 can be protruded on the upper plate 20 such that a plurality of reinforcing pieces 28 (see FIG. 7) have a predetermined pattern. That is, the convexly formed upper portion of the upper plate 20 and the reinforcing bristles 28 are formed to maintain the durability (the material of the upper plate is made of synthetic resin, so that the durability is required to be improved).

Further, the lid part 25 can be rotatably mounted on the upper plate part 20 at one side. Accordingly, by opening and closing the lid part 25, water or rice can be added or added in a state in which the upper plate part 20 is mounted on the upper part of the inner pot 50.

In addition, a plurality of slit holes 26 may be formed on the upper surface of the upper plate 20 to have a predetermined pattern. Accordingly, water can be drained from the inner pot (50) in the state that the upper plate (20) is mounted on the inner pot (50), or further water can be injected.

On the other hand, a plurality of mounting portions 21 (21a, 21b) are formed on the outer circumferential surface of the upper plate portion 20. The mounting portions 21 and 21a and 21b may have slit grooves 22 formed therein so that the flange 51 of the inner pot 50 is rotated when the upper plate 20 is rotated in one direction with the upper plate 20 mounted on the inner pot 50. [ 51a, 51b of the upper plate 20 can be fastened.

On the other hand, the handle portion 30 is mounted at the center of the upper plate portion 20. Specifically, the handle portion 30 is composed of a knob 31 and a lever 32 for gripping, and is configured to be rotated in the upper plate portion 20.

The rotary shaft 42 of the wing 40 is mounted on the end of the lever 32 of the handle 30. Accordingly, the wing 40 can be rotated by the user rotating the handle 30.

The wing portion 40 is formed at a position where the two cleaning wings 41 and 42 are symmetrical with respect to each other with respect to the rotation axis 43 in the above-described configuration. Of course, although two of them are illustrated in the accompanying drawings, the present invention is not limited thereto, and a plurality of them may be formed.

On the other hand, a plurality of through holes (h1) are formed in the washing vanes (41, 42), so that the resistance of water when washing rice can be reduced. Further, it is preferable that the washing vanes 41 and 42 are formed to have a size such that the washing vanes 41 and 42 are substantially in close contact with the inner peripheral surface of the inner pot 50. That is, it is preferable that the washing vanes 42 are closely attached to the inner surface of the inner pot 50 so that the rice contained in the inner pot 50 is efficiently washed during the manual rotation of the vanes 40.

The rice washing machine of the present invention can be attached to the flange 51 of the inner pot 50 of the rice cooker by fitting it into the mounting portion 21 formed on the upper plate 20. As a result, the usability is increased, and there is an advantage that it is structurally simple.

Further, there is an advantage in that it is not necessary to separately provide a semi-container by using the inner pot 50 of the conventional rice cooker as it is as a rice washing container.
